Insider Tips from Elite MS in CS & IT Students: Strategies for Success

Struggling to maintain motivation throughout your MS in CS & IT? 

Break down your course into manageable tasks, stay focused on your end goal, and consistently take action.

Want to take it a step further?

Follow industry leaders on LinkedIn and gain inspiration for your journey. 

Who knows where it could take you in just a few short years?

Insider Tips from Elite MS in CS & IT Students

If you want to skip the reading, then jump directly to:

  • Rohit Jain- ML Engineer- Twitter- Cornell University  
  • Columbia University -Ben Mills-head of product at Venmo
  • University of California, Los Angeles (UCLA) -Vint Cerf-  VP at Google
  • The University of Washington-Jeremy Jaech- co-founded Aldus Corporation 
  • Princeton University- Edward Tian-  GPTZero
  • UWM: University of Wisconsin-Milwaukee-Satya Nadella- Microsoft CEO

1. Rohit Jain – ML Engineer -Twitter:

Rohit Jain


Rohit Jain is an individual with a strong interest in impactful products that affect people’s lives. 

He became fascinated with the Twitter revolution and its ability to create a large-scale impact. 

As a Computer Engineering undergraduate, Jain worked on various projects involving Twitter data analysis, specifically focusing on micro-communities related to the Indian Premier League. Rather than pursuing a conventional computer science degree, he opted for a Jacobs Technion-Cornell Dual Master of Science Degree with a Concentration in Connective Media. 

Jain believes in understanding both the human aspect of technology and the intricacies of its systems, which he found in this program.


Tip 1: Pursue your passion: Rohit Jain was interested in products that impact people’s lives, and he was fascinated by the Twitter revolution. Following your passion and being genuinely interested in the work you do can drive your success.

Tip 2: Seek unconventional paths: Jain chose to pursue a Jacobs Technion-Cornell Dual Master of Science Degree with a Concentration in Connective Media instead of a traditional computer science degree. Exploring unique educational opportunities can provide a different perspective and open doors to new experiences.

Tip 3: Understand the human aspect of technology: Jain believed in the importance of understanding how technology connects humans and impacts their lives. Recognizing the human element and considering the social and psychological aspects of technology can be valuable in creating meaningful solutions.

Tip 4: Expand knowledge and skills: During his time at Cornell Tech, Jain focused on improving his machine learning knowledge while deep diving into HCI research. Continuous learning and expanding your skill set can enhance your expertise and open up new opportunities.

Tip 5: Collaborate and network: Jain collaborated with teammates to create Palpiction, worked with engineers at Twitter, and fostered connections. Building strong relationships and collaborating with others can lead to valuable opportunities and support in your career journey.

Tip 6: Identify and pursue opportunities: Jain identified an opportunity for creating a new team at Twitter and worked hard to validate the idea and gain support from top leadership. Being proactive in identifying opportunities and taking initiative can drive your career growth.

Tip 7: Think big and validate ideas: Jain emphasized the importance of thinking bigger and finding ways to validate ideas faster. Adopting an iterative product development approach and experimenting with new features can lead to learning and growth.

Tip 8: Foster empathy: Jain mentioned being empathetic to the people he works with as one of the qualities that helped him succeed. Practicing empathy can strengthen relationships, enhance teamwork, and contribute to a positive work environment.

Tip 9: Stay updated with industry trends: Jain predicted that responsible ML and the impact of recommendation products on mental health would be major themes in the future. Keeping up with industry trends and being aware of emerging issues can help you stay relevant and make informed decisions.

Tip 10: Share knowledge and mentor others: Jain assists in hiring and mentoring new engineers and actively collaborates with other teams. Sharing knowledge, mentoring others, and fostering growth in your team can contribute to your own success and the success of those around you.

2. Ben Mills – Head of Product at Venmo – Columbia University


Ben Mills has expertise in product management and has played a key role in the development and success of Venmo, a popular mobile payment service.

Ben Mills received his bachelor’s degree from Columbia University, where he studied computer science.


  • Tip 1: Ben Mills’ advice to stay curious and open-minded. 
  • Tip 2: Staying up-to-date with the latest technologies and developments is essential. 
  • Tip 3: Keeping an open mind and being willing to explore new ideas and approaches can help you stay engaged and excited about your coursework.

3. Vint Cerf – VP at Google – University of California, Los Angeles (UCLA)


Vint Cerf is known for his pioneering work in developing the internet and his advocacy for net neutrality. 

He has also been involved in several other technology initiatives, including developing the interplanetary internet.


  • Tip 1: A big part of leadership is learning to sell your ideas. Great leaders are also great salespeople – both know how to use persuasion for influence.
  • Tip 2: To do the impossible, first, you have to convince other people that it isn’t. Justify the timeline, set reachable targets, and show confidence that the team can succeed.
  • Tip 3: Be empathetic with those you are leading. Understand the environment and issues of those who work for you so you can be empathetic towards them.
  • Tip 4: Engineers should be reminded to make something useful so that sales can succeed (and they can succeed too). Work to create something that is actually useful for people.
  • Tip 5: Humility is vital for leadership. You don’t know everything, so you shouldn’t be afraid to ask questions. It is not a sign of weakness to want to learn something, especially from people that report to you.
  • Tip 6: People that report to you have to be comfortable asking for help. Create an environment where people that report to you feel comfortable telling you when they need help.
  • Tip 7: Listen, listen, listen. You have to show you are listening, provide feedback, and reflect. Direct feedback is important. Without listening to customers, you can never truly improve your products.
  • Tip 8: Experience counts. Even when you are feeling imposter syndrome and unsure if you belong, remember everybody gets into that situation occasionally. And what you should do is get help, particularly from people more experienced and smarter than you are.

4. Jeremy Jaech – Co-Founded Aldus Corporation – University of Washington


Jeremy Jaech has software development and entrepreneurship expertise and has founded several successful companies in the technology industry.


  • Tip 1: Identify gaps in the market: The founder of Shapeware, Jeremy Jaech, stresses finding gaps in the market to fill with your own research or entrepreneurial venture potentially.
  • Tip 2: Stay up-to-date with the latest technology: Jaech found that many users were still using mid-1980s software to achieve their desired results because they were uncomfortable with the latest versions.
  • Tip 3: Customisation is key: As an MS student, you can look for ways to add customization options to your work, such as tailoring your research to specific industries or sectors.
  • Tip 4: Exploit opportunities in the market: Both Aldus and Shapeware were founded by individuals who identified opportunities that allowed their companies to thrive. As an MS student, watch for opportunities that can help you stand out in your field.
  • Tip 5: Learn from past experiences: Jaech noted that his second fortune would be easier because he knew what he was doing. As an MS student, learn from your past experiences, successes, and failures and use that knowledge to make better decisions in the future.

5. Edward Tian – GPTZero – Princeton University

Edward Tian


Edward Tian is an artificial intelligence and machine learning expert and has been involved in several AI-related startups.

Edward Tian is a Chinese entrepreneur and technology executive who founded GPTZero, a startup focused on developing artificial intelligence technology. 

He received his bachelor’s degree in electrical engineering from Princeton University and later co-founded China Netcom, a major telecommunications company in China.


  • Tip 1: Stay informed about the potential impact of large AI models like ChatGPT in academic and professional settings.
  • Tip 2: Understand the importance of responsible AI adoption and build safeguards to prevent AI from being abused by bad actors, such as bots, misinformation, election interference campaigns, and trust and safety violations misrepresented as human.
  • Tip 3: Be aware of AI detection tools like GPTZero, which can detect whether a human or machine writes a text.
  • Tip 4: Learn about the indicators that GPTZero uses to analyze text, such as perplexity and burstiness. Perplexity refers to how complex or random a text might be, while burstiness refers to patterns of diversity in sentence structure.
  • Tip 5: Work towards improving the accuracy of AI detection tools like GPTZero and other AI models.
  • Tip 6: Engage in discussions about the responsible use of AI with various school boards and scholarships, and advocate for promoting equity and transparency in AI adoption.

6. Satya Nadella – Microsoft CEO – UWM: University of Wisconsin-Milwaukee

Satya Nadella


Satya Nadella has expertise in technology leadership and has played a key role in the growth and success of Microsoft.

He has also been involved in several initiatives to promote diversity and inclusion in the tech industry.

Satya Nadella is an Indian-American technology executive currently CEO of Microsoft, one of the world’s largest software companies. 


  • Tip 1: Stay adaptable and resilient. Pursuing an MS in CS & IT can be challenging, but adapting to changing circumstances and setbacks can help you stay motivated in your studies.
  • Tip 2: Don’t be afraid to change with the times.
  • Tip 3: Be curious and constantly learn.
  • Tip 4: Learn to Empathize.
  • Tip 5: Build a strong team and empower them to succeed. Focus on the customer and do not give up easily.
  • Tip 6: Do not focus on the past. Be open about shortcomings.
  • Tip 7: Do not forget where you came from and do not be afraid of change.

While these tips from successful performers are a great starting point, remember that success takes effort and dedication.

College Finder

Get personalized assistance to shortlist colleges, programs etc based on your profile.

Leave a Comment

Your email address will not be published. Required fields are marked *